Do hamsters like to be held?

Hamsters can be trained to enjoy and tolerate being held. Your hamster's species and his personality will influence how much he likes being held and how long it takes to tame him. Some hamsters enjoy being held, while others may only tolerate it for a short amount of time before they are ready to be put back down.

Is a 20 gallon tank good for a hamster?

We think a 20 gallon hamster tank is a good option for most hamster breeds, and probably the minimum you should consider for a Syrian hamster. Ideally you want the bottom floor of your 20 gallon hamster tank to be long and low. A 30 gallon tank however would be better, and a 40 gallon tank ideal.

Can I put my hamster cage on the floor?

Don't put the cage outdoors. Don't put the cage on a basement floor as these tend to get cold, especially in the winter and at night. If you must keep your hamster in the basement, raise the cage up by putting it on some kind of sturdy platform. And provide plenty of bedding material so your hamster can burrow deep.

Do hamsters need sand baths?

Whilst hamsters can have negative reactions to water baths, many really enjoy sand baths. Sand bathing is a natural way for your pet to clean itself. You can purchase special sand for this, but if you can't find hamster bathing sand, then chinchilla sand will do just as well.

What is the most social hamster?

Dwarf Campbell Russian Hamsters (Phodopus campbelli) Dwarf Campbell Russian hamsters are more social than Syrian hamsters, and they can be kept in same sex pairs or groups of their breed as long as they are introduced at a young age.

Do hamsters smell?

Hamsters don't stink but, if you aren't diligent, their cages sure will. A hamster's cage needs a full cleaning at least once a week. Dump all of the bedding and scrub the enclosure thoroughly with a mild detergent and warm water, then re-line it with brand new bedding.

How much do hamsters cost?

In general, a hamster will cost between five to fifteen dollars in a shop, and a bit more if you're buying an unusual variety.

How much bedding should you put in a hamster cage?

It's not enough to simply cover the cage or tank bottom. Bedding is meant to provide comfort for the animal and should not be used sparingly. A depth of 2 to 3 inches will allow your hamster to burrow and allow plenty of excess after your daily cleaning removal.

How often should I change my hamsters bedding?

How Often To Change Hamster Bedding? It's a recommendation from the ASPCA to remove all old shavings in hamster cages and replace them with completely fresh ones at least once a week. You should scrub the cage using hot, soapy water every week too.
